ssrlinux客户端命令行

fiy 其他 19

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在ssr客户端使用命令行可以方便地管理和控制其运行,以下是一些常用的ssrlinux客户端命令行:

    1. 安装ssrlinux客户端
    “`
    sudo apt-get install python-pip
    pip install shadowsocks
    “`

    2. 启动ssrlinux客户端
    “`
    sslocal -s 服务器地址 -p 服务器端口 -k 密码 -m 加密方法 -l 本地监听地址 -b 本地监听端口 -d start
    “`
    示例:
    “`
    sslocal -s 123.456.789.0 -p 443 -k mypassword -m aes-256-cfb -l 127.0.0.1 -b 1080 -d start
    “`

    3. 停止ssrlinux客户端
    “`
    sslocal -d stop
    “`

    4. 设置ssrlinux客户端配置文件
    默认配置文件路径为`/etc/shadowsocks.json`,可以使用以下命令进行编辑:
    “`
    vi /etc/shadowsocks.json
    “`

    5. 配置ssrlinux客户端
    通常情况下,可以直接修改`/etc/shadowsocks.json`文件,设置服务器地址、端口、密码等参数,然后重启ssrlinux客户端即可生效。

    6. 查看ssrlinux客户端运行日志
    “`
    tail -f /var/log/shadowsocks.log
    “`

    7. 开机自动启动ssrlinux客户端
    编辑`/etc/rc.local`文件,在`exit 0`前添加以下命令:
    “`
    /usr/bin/sslocal -c /etc/shadowsocks.json -d start
    “`

    注意:上述命令中的参数根据具体情况进行修改。使用ssrlinux客户端命令行时,需要具备系统管理员权限,可以使用sudo命令进行操作。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    SSRLinux客户端是一款轻量级的命令行工具,用于管理和操作SSRLinux系统。它提供了一系列的命令和选项,可以帮助用户完成各种任务。下面是一些常用的SSRLinux客户端命令行:

    1. `ssrcli`:这是SSRLinux客户端的主要命令行工具。可以使用该命令行工具来执行各种操作,如创建、管理和删除虚拟机,进行网络设置,查看虚拟机状态等。

    2. `ssrcli create`:使用该命令可以创建一个新的虚拟机。可以指定虚拟机的名称、镜像、CPU、内存等参数。例如,`ssrcli create –name myvm –image ubuntu –cpu 2 –memory 4096`将创建一个名为myvm的虚拟机,使用ubuntu镜像,2个CPU核心和4GB内存。

    3. `ssrcli start`:该命令可以启动一个已经创建的虚拟机。只需指定虚拟机的名称即可。例如,`ssrcli start –name myvm`将启动名为myvm的虚拟机。

    4. `ssrcli stop`:该命令可以停止一个正在运行的虚拟机。同样,只需指定虚拟机的名称即可。例如,`ssrcli stop –name myvm`将停止名为myvm的虚拟机。

    5. `ssrcli list`:使用该命令可以列出所有已创建的虚拟机。可以获取虚拟机的名称、状态、IP地址等信息。例如,`ssrcli list`将列出所有已创建的虚拟机的信息。

    6. `ssrcli delete`:该命令可以删除一个已经停止的虚拟机。只需指定虚拟机的名称即可。例如,`ssrcli delete –name myvm`将删除名为myvm的虚拟机。

    以上是一些常用的SSRLinux客户端命令行。通过使用这些命令,用户可以轻松地管理和操作SSRLinux系统中的虚拟机。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    SSR(ShadowsocksR)是一种基于Socks5代理的翻墙工具,通过混淆和加密技术,能够有效绕过网络封锁,实现访问被封锁的网站。SSR客户端支持多平台,包括Windows、MacOS、Linux等操作系统。在Linux系统中,可以通过命令行方式来安装和配置SSR客户端。

    下面是在Linux系统中使用SSR客户端的步骤和命令行操作:

    1. 安装SSR客户端
    首先,需要从ShadowsocksR的代码仓库中下载SSR客户端的源码。可以使用如下命令克隆代码仓库到本地:
    “`
    git clone -b manyuser https://github.com/shadowsocksrr/shadowsocksr.git
    “`

    2. 进入SSR客户端目录
    安装源码后,需要进入SSR客户端的目录,可以使用如下命令:
    “`
    cd shadowsocksr/shadowsocks
    “`

    3. 配置SSR客户端
    在进入SSR客户端目录后,可以使用命令行参数来配置SSR客户端。下面是一些常用的命令行参数示例:
    – `-s` 设置服务器IP地址
    – `-p` 设置服务器端口号
    – `-m` 设置加密方法
    – `-k` 设置密码
    – `-O` 设置混淆方式
    – `-o` 设置混淆参数
    – `-b` 设置本地监听地址
    – `-l` 设置本地监听端口

    例如,要连接到服务器IP地址为`example.com`,端口号为`12345`,加密方法为`aes-256-cfb`,密码为`password`,混淆方式为`http_simple`,混淆参数为`example.com`,本地监听地址为`127.0.0.1`,本地监听端口为`1080`,可以使用如下命令进行配置:
    “`
    python local.py -s example.com -p 12345 -m aes-256-cfb -k password -O http_simple -o example.com -b 127.0.0.1 -l 1080
    “`

    4. 启动SSR客户端
    配置完成后,可以使用如下命令启动SSR客户端:
    “`
    python local.py
    “`

    5. 验证SSR客户端是否正常工作
    启动SSR客户端后,可以使用浏览器或者其他应用程序来验证SSR客户端是否正常工作。通常情况下,可以通过设置系统代理或者应用程序代理来将流量转发到SSR客户端,从而实现访问被封锁的网站。

    以上就是在Linux系统中使用SSR客户端的命令行操作流程。通过这些命令,可以方便地配置和启动SSR客户端,实现翻墙访问。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部